A read from /proc/sys/kernel/sched_rt_runtime_us leads to backtrace due
to missing cpu_hotplug_lock with CONFIG_CPUSETS=n. The callchain is
sched_rt_handler() -> partition_sched_domains() -> sched_cache_set() ->
static_key_enable_cpuslocked(&sched_cache_present).

sched_cache_set() itself is also invoked from sched_init_domains() which
is early during the boot, holding just the sched_domains_mutex_lock().
Here is no warning because it happens before user space is running (and
hotplug operations are not possible).

There is also sched_cache_active_set() which acquires the hotplug lock
before invoking any of the _cpuslocked() functions.

This is only a problem with CONFIG_CPUSETS=n because in the =y case the
other implementation of rebuild_sched_domains acquires the CPU-hotplug
lock.

Acquire CPU hotplug lock before in rebuild_sched_domains(), before
partition_sched_domains() is invoked for the CONFIG_CPUSETS=n case.

diff --git a/include/linux/cpuset.h b/include/linux/cpuset.h
index 65d76a38974ba..bf3999daa080a 100644
--- a/include/linux/cpuset.h
+++ b/include/linux/cpuset.h
@@ -273,6 +273,7 @@ static inline void dl_rebuild_rd_accounting(void)
 
 static inline void rebuild_sched_domains(void)
 {
+	guard(cpus_read_lock)();
 	partition_sched_domains(1, NULL, NULL);
 }
